Who needs judicial recusal and attorney?

01
Parties involved in a legal case: Both plaintiffs and defendants may require a judicial recusal and attorney under certain circumstances. If they believe that the current judge overseeing their case may have a biased opinion, a conflict of interest, or any other matter that could potentially hinder a fair trial, they may seek recusal and legal representation.
02
Attorneys involved in a case: Attorneys may also need to file for a recusal and attorney if they believe the judge's impartiality could affect their client's rights or if they have a conflict of interest with the judge. It is essential for attorneys to ensure a fair legal process for their clients.
03
Judges themselves: In some instances, judges may also voluntarily recuse themselves from hearing a case due to a potential conflict of interest or personal relationship with a party involved. Their unbiased and neutral stance is critical for maintaining the integrity of the legal system.

Judicial recusal is when a judge steps down from a case due to a conflict of interest or bias. An attorney is a legal professional who represents clients in court.
Judges are required to file for judicial recusal, and attorneys may need to file for recusal in certain circumstances.
Judicial recusal forms can typically be obtained from the court clerk's office and require specific details about the conflict of interest or bias. Attorney recusal may involve submitting a formal motion to the court.
The purpose of judicial recusal is to ensure a fair and impartial legal process, while attorney recusal is to prevent conflicts of interest that could compromise the case.
The recusal form typically requires details about the nature of the conflict of interest or bias, as well as any relevant relationships that may compromise the legal proceedings.
